Elimination Of the Endocrine Disruptor – Parabens
Parabens are commonly used ingredients in most cosmetic skincare products. However, it interferes with the body’s endocrine system and leaves adverse effects on the human body's reproductive, neurological, immunity, and developmental processes, including wildlife.
How do you know a skincare product has parabens?
Added fragrances and preservation is your cue. Products with added scents, fragrances, and preservation promises usually contain parabens. Types of parabens that are usually added include propylparaben, butylparaben, isobutylparaben, methylparaben and polyparaben. -

The Bleacher of Nature – Oxybenzone
All these beautiful, colorful coral reefs to witness, and we’re still using oxybenzone without knowing its truth. Oxybenzone is a natural bleacher that directly impacts coral reefs leading to their discolouration. Besides that, it also is an endocrine-disruptor like parabens (as discussed above). Oxybenzone is used as an active ingredient in most sunscreens, and while it protects the skin from harmful UV radiations, one cannot deny that it harms the environment. Did you know that in Hawaii, the usage of oxybenzone is banned to protect coral reefs? Yes, it’s that serious. Should avoid sunscreens containing oxybenzone and benzophenone-3. The Known Carcinogen – Formaldehyde
Formaldehyde is known as an active carcinogen. Even products or materials containing formaldehyde-releasing substances can have this effect after long usage. These substances are most commonly found in shampoos, soaps and lotions. Besides acting as a carcinogen, it also causes skin irritation and has allergic reactions among many individuals.
